What affects the price

When planning a hardscape project, several factors influence your final investment. The total square footage is the primary driver, but the complexity of the design—such as curves, patterns, or multi-level tiers—adds to labor time. Site accessibility matters too; if crews need specialized equipment to move materials into a tight backyard, that affects the bottom line. Material choice, from standard concrete blocks to premium natural stone, significantly shifts the budget. Additionally, your current ground condition determines how much excavation and base preparation is required for long-term stability.

Do I really need sand under pavers for my Orlando patio?

Yes, a proper sand setting bed is absolutely crucial for paver installation in Orlando. It ensures a level surface, allows for proper drainage, and helps prevent shifting, which is vital given the rainfall and soil conditions here. The pros ensure this is done right.

What is meant by hardscaping in Orlando?

Hardscaping in Orlando refers to the non-living elements of your landscape design. This includes patios, walkways, driveways, and retaining walls made from durable materials like pavers, stone, or concrete, designed to enhance your property's functionality and aesthetic appeal.
